Output c4f33a0e1617456b9cbf9bf30ef64b8f225807933ee2728d2a6c87f019d1b9c5:1

value
16334554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aaeb089ae29a951c4e40684e93a3c60064b6c2b OP_EQUAL
address
3ELJSfPFqZkyQEu212eCEp27bo9RZh3ekb
transaction
c4f33a0e1617456b9cbf9bf30ef64b8f225807933ee2728d2a6c87f019d1b9c5
confirmations
315464
spent
true